diff --git a/Telegram/SourceFiles/calls/calls_group_panel.cpp b/Telegram/SourceFiles/calls/calls_group_panel.cpp index 9492adfc77..c5408dbcaf 100644 --- a/Telegram/SourceFiles/calls/calls_group_panel.cpp +++ b/Telegram/SourceFiles/calls/calls_group_panel.cpp @@ -609,13 +609,13 @@ void Panel::setupJoinAsChangedToasts() { return (state == State::Joined); }) | rpl::take(1); }) | rpl::flatten_latest() | rpl::start_with_next([=] { - Ui::ShowMultilineToast({ - .parentOverride = widget(), + Ui::ShowMultilineToast(Ui::MultilineToastArgs{ .text = tr::lng_group_call_join_as_changed( tr::now, lt_name, Ui::Text::Bold(_call->joinAs()->name), Ui::Text::WithEntities), + .parentOverride = widget(), }); }, widget()->lifetime()); } @@ -629,13 +629,13 @@ void Panel::setupTitleChangedToasts() { ? _peer->name : _peer->groupCall()->title(); }) | rpl::start_with_next([=](const QString &title) { - Ui::ShowMultilineToast({ - .parentOverride = widget(), + Ui::ShowMultilineToast(Ui::MultilineToastArgs{ .text = tr::lng_group_call_title_changed( tr::now, lt_title, Ui::Text::Bold(title), Ui::Text::WithEntities), + .parentOverride = widget(), }); }, widget()->lifetime()); } diff --git a/Telegram/SourceFiles/ui/toasts/common_toasts.h b/Telegram/SourceFiles/ui/toasts/common_toasts.h index ebf1efe1d7..33b1db0cdc 100644 --- a/Telegram/SourceFiles/ui/toasts/common_toasts.h +++ b/Telegram/SourceFiles/ui/toasts/common_toasts.h @@ -12,9 +12,9 @@ https://github.com/telegramdesktop/tdesktop/blob/master/LEGAL namespace Ui { struct MultilineToastArgs { - QWidget *parentOverride = nullptr; TextWithEntities text; crl::time duration = 0; + QWidget *parentOverride = nullptr; }; void ShowMultilineToast(MultilineToastArgs &&args);